John is adding a curved edge to the landscaping in front of the high school. The curve is an arc of a circle with a radius of 16 00 feet. The central angle that intercepts the curve measures π/8 radians. The length of the curve to the nearest foot is _____ feet.
1 answer:
By definition, the arc length is given by: S = R * theta Where, Theta: central angle R: radio Substituting the values we have: S = (1600) * (π / 8) Rewriting we have: S = 200π feet S = 628.3185307 feet Round to the nearest foot: S = 628 feet Answer: The length of the curve to the nearest foot is 628 feet.
